U.S. rocker Rick Springfield has revealed he only owns half of the smash hit he wrote and recorded - but that's been enough to buy him "several houses".
The singer/songwriter enjoyed worldwide success with '80s anthem Jessie's Girl but he doesn't own the copyright of the song outright.
He says, "I only own half the song, although I'm the writer of Jessie's Girl. I only own half the publishing. That was the deal that was made way back when I was kind of clueless about business."
But he isn't complaining - Springfield tells U.S. news show Access Hollywood, "It's bought me several houses."
